Jaish militant killed in Budgam encounter: Police | KNO

Youth sustained bullet wound in clashes at gunfight site

Srinagar, June 28 (KNO) : A Jaish-e-Muhammad militant was killed in a gunbattle with government forces at Kralpora, Checkpora, in Central Kashmir’s Budgam district on Friday, police said. A youth was also seriously injured in the clashes near the encounter site, witnesses said. Witnesses told KNO said that a joint operation as launched by the 50 Rashtriya Riffles, SoG and CRPF. As the forces tried to zero in on the house where the militant was hiding, he opened a volley of bullets triggered a fierce encounter. “In the ensuing gunbattle, the militant was killed and later identified as Abu Zarar , a resident of Pakistan. He was affiliated with Jaish-e-Muhammad outfit.” Police spokesman in a statement issued to KNO said as per police records, the slain militant as affiliated with proscribed outfit JeM and was wanted by law for his complicity in crimes including attack on security establishments and civilian atrocities. “According to the police records, he was part of groups involved in planning and executing attacks in the area and many other civilian atrocities. Several terror crime cases were registered against him,” he said. “Incriminating material including arms & ammunition were recovered from the site of encounter. All these materials have been taken into case records for further investigation and to probe their complicity in other crimes.” Meanwhile, during the intense clashes between youth and forces at the encounter site, a youth sustained bullet injury in his abdomen. “He was referred to SMHS hospital where his condition was stated as critical,” hospital sources revealed.(KNO)
